UX Designer 

Melbourne, AUS (Hybrid) | Product Team | Shape the Future of Construction Tech

Want to design products people don’t just use, but rely on every day?
At Buildxact, we’re helping builders and trades run smarter businesses with less chaos. We’re looking for a UX Designer who can turn complex workflows into simple, intuitive, and beautiful experiences that drive real customer impact.

What You’ll Be Doing:

Own the end-to-end UX process from concept to launch and beyond

Design user flows, wireframes, and prototypes that simplify complex workflows

Run user research, testing, and validation to uncover real customer needs

Translate insights into clear, actionable product and design decisions

Collaborate closely with Product, Engineering, and cross-functional teams to bring ideas to life

Facilitate workshops and drive alignment across stakeholders

Create high-quality designs ready for developer handoff—and iterate post-launch based on data

Help establish and evolve the Buildxact design system for consistency and scale

Provide thought leadership on UX trends, interaction patterns, and emerging tech

Mentor and guide others on best practices in user-centered design

You’ll Thrive If You Have:

Experience designing UX for SaaS or digital products

A strong user-first mindset—you simplify, clarify, and remove friction

Confidence working end-to-end across research, design, testing, and delivery

Experience collaborating with engineering teams in agile environments

A natural curiosity and bias toward testing, learning, and improving

Strong communication skills—you can explain design decisions clearly and influence stakeholders

Experience building or contributing to design systems

A passion for solving real-world problems with elegant, practical solutions

Bonus points if you’ve worked in construction, trades, or workflow-heavy industries
